Latest Patents
Hansson's latest patents include a "Retention and Drainage Aid" and a "Process for the Preparation of Polymeric Amine Containing Products." The first patent focuses on cross-linked, cationic polymers that feature a mixture of secondary and/or tertiary alkylene amine groups and alkylene quaternary ammonium groups. These polymers are designed to enhance retention and drainage in paper making processes. The second patent outlines a method for creating polymeric products with a high degree of pendant secondary or tertiary alkylene amino groups. This process involves the interaction of a hydrocarbon polymer with a primary or secondary amine, carbon monoxide, and hydrogen, facilitated by a catalytic amount of a Group VIII metal compound.
